Bridge Alliance and Singtel partner to launch regional telco API exchange powered by Singtel Paragon platform

  • Written by: PR Newswire Asia - Daily Bulletin Au RSS

Bridge Alliance API exchange (BAEx) enables regional and multinational enterprises to gain seamless access to multi-market telco assets, unlocking new innovation and business opportunities

SINGAPORE, July 24,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Bridge Alliance, a leading mobile alliance of 34 member operators worldwide, and Singtel, a leading communications technology group in Asia, today announced a strategic partnership to accelerate regional Application Programming Interface (API) federation with a telco API exchange powered by Singtel's Paragon, the all-in-one orchestration platform for telco networks.

Bridge Alliance is launching the Bridge Alliance API Exchange (BAEx), which leverages Paragon to aggregate its member operators' network authentication, user verification and network quality APIs. With BAEx, enterprises and developers can streamline the deployment of new services on member operator networks by accessing a common API framework, which provides secure, consistent and on-demand access to telco network capabilities across multiple regions. This enables the regional aggregation and standardisation of telco APIs utilising CAMARA[1] APIs.

Building on Singtel and Bridge Alliance's experience with its ecosystem of member telecom operators, BAEx will significantly reduce complexity and friction for enterprise customers, developers, and solution providers through its unified integration, simplified commercial framework and common operational support model. The APIs offered will support regional and global enterprise use cases in fintech, e-commerce and over-the-top providers starting with network authentication, user verification and location tracking functions. This will also help enterprises accelerate time-to-market to launch their services and reduce the complexity of working with multiple telecommunication operators.

About Bridge Alliance

Bridge Alliance, the leading mobile alliance for premier operators and their customers in Asia Pacific, the Middle East and Africa, celebrates its 20th anniversary in 2024. Founded by seven leading operators in 2004 with a focus on regional roaming, our alliance today covers 34 members who serve over 1 billion customers collectively across these regions. Our goal is to build group capabilities and create value for our members by enabling compelling roaming services and experience, offering multi-market enterprise and IoT solutions, and delivering savings and benefits through leveraging group economies.

Bridge Alliance's members and partners include: Airtel (India, Sri Lanka and the Airtel subsidiaries in Africa: Chad, Congo, Democratic Republic of the Congo, Gabon, Kenya, Malawi, Madagascar, Niger, Nigeria, Rwanda, Seychelles, Tanzania, Uganda and Zambia), AIS (Thailand), China Telecom (Mainland China), China Unicom (Mainland China), CSL Mobile (Hong Kong), CTM (Macau), Globe Telecom (Philippines), Maxis (Malaysia), Metfone (Cambodia), MobiFone (Vietnam), Optus (Australia), Singtel (Singapore), SK Telecom (South Korea), stc (Saudi Arabia, Bahrain, Kuwait), SoftBank Corp. (Japan), Taiwan Mobile (Taiwan), and Telkomsel (Indonesia).

[1] CAMARA is an open source project within Linux Foundation to define, develop and test the APIs. CAMARA works in close collaboration with the GSMA Operator Platform Group to align API requirements and publish API definitions and APIs. Harmonisation of APIs is achieved through fast and agile created working code with developer-friendly documentation.
